Support the educational journey of Indigenous students as an Indigenous Education Support Worker with School District No. 73. This role requires cultural insight and education assistance for diverse learners.
School District No. 73 is actively seeking candidates for its Indigenous Education Worker Relief roster. Applicants must possess Indigenous ancestry and demonstrate a thorough understanding of cultural and contemporary Indigenous issues. Experience working with children is a critical aspect of this role.
Key Responsibilities:
• Provide tailored support for Indigenous students
• Assist in understanding cultural significance in education
• Travel to diverse communities for outreach
• Collaborate with educators to improve student outcomes
• Participate in promoting Indigenous traditions and topics
Requirements:
• Grade 12 diploma with additional post-secondary education
• At least two years of relevant experience
• Valid B.C. Driver's License required...
